Why Do People Do Reiki?

People do Reiki for many reasons. Some want to reduce stress. Others want to heal emotional wounds. Some want to help others. Others want to grow spiritually.

The reasons are as varied as the people. But there are common threads. Most people do Reiki for healing. They want to feel better. They want to help others feel better.

People do Reiki for many reasons: stress reduction and relaxation, anxiety relief, pain management, emotional healing, better sleep, personal growth, spiritual development, helping others, and overall well-being. Some people use Reiki for specific conditions. Others use it for general wellness. Many people practice Reiki as part of their self-care routine. Others practice it as a profession. The reasons are personal and varied.
